Unlock Your Body's Calorie-Crushing Potential: Boosting Mitochondrial Function
Mitochondria are often referred to as the powerhouses of our cells, responsible for generating energy through cellular respiration. When these microscopic organelles function optimally, your body can effectively harness fuel from food into usable energy, promoting weight loss and overall well-being. To ignite mitochondrial performance, consider incorporating certain lifestyle choices and dietary habits into your routine. Engaging in regular aerobic exercise has been proven to stimulate mitochondrial biogenesis, essentially creating more mitochondria within your cells. Furthermore, consuming a diet rich in antioxidants can help protect these powerhouses from damage caused by free radicals.
- Certain types of exercise, such as high-intensity interval training (HIIT), have been shown to greatly boost mitochondrial activity.
- Emphasizing foods packed with antioxidants, like berries, leafy greens, and nuts, can protect mitochondria from oxidative stress.
By making these conscious efforts, you can unleash your body's fat-burning potential and optimize your overall health and fitness.
